Cooking in France is considered one of the fine arts! Learn to cook fabulous French cuisine in this small hands-on cooking class with an experienced chef who travels to France twice a year. After learning new techniques and dishes, enjoy a four course lunch with French wine overlooking the bay.
The joys of the table are everything to the French and food is a constant conversation. Cooking is a pleasure, they cook because they want to eat well and they love the 'cooking' process. Discover this pleasure by taking a culinary journey through France. Learn to make stocks and sauces, the foundation of good cooking; learn to cook regional specialties, classic dishes, and la nouvelle cuisine, the cuisine of today, with fresher, lighter, contemporary dishes. Enjoy the tastes, textures, and aromas of simple and sophisticated French food. You'll cook cheese and dessert soufflés, magret de canard, coq au vin, the art of boning chicken for a ballotine de volaille aux pistaches, you'll cook Boeuf Bourguignon, terrines and pâtés, tartes, crème brûlée, chocolate mousse, regional favourites such as the pissaladière, la Bourride, soupe au pistou, truites aux amandes, tarte aux poires Normande and clafoutis. Afterwards, sit down and enjoy your efforts with French wine. Bon appétit!
All participants must be over 18 years, unless accompanied by a participant who is an adult
Classes are limited to 8 participants with one chef plus a kitchen steward assistant.
Participants are asked to wear covered in, comfortable shoes, for safety reasons. For health reasons, those with long hair will need to bring a hair tie to tie back the hair.
This experience offers a unique hands-on cooking class day, learning to cook whilst experiencing the glorious view of Port Phillip Bay. The class culminates with your wonderful luncheon, served at a beautifully set table, with wine and sparkling water plus interesting conversation. You feel like you are at a private dinner party with friends. All classes cook appetisers, soups or entrées, main course, and, usually, a dessert trio.
Located just opposite the St Kilda boat marina, approximately 8km from the CBD. Free parking is available in the street. Accessible by bus and tram.
